600ps max. propagation delay
Extended 100E VEE range of –4.2V to –5.5V
True and complementary outputs
OR/NOR function outputs
Fully compatible with Industry standard 10KH,
100K I/O levels
Internal 75K input pulldown resistors
Fully compatible with Motorola MC10E/100E107
Available in 28-pin PLCC package
The SY10/100E107 offer five 2-input XOR/XNOR gates
and are designed for use in new, high- performance ECL
systems.
The E107 also features a function output, F, which is the
OR of all five XOR gate outputs, while F is the NOR. Both
true and complementary outputs are provided.
